Bobby Buggs Posted December 8, 2007 Report Share Posted December 8, 2007 Went to the Neuro Thursday. He said I was lucky to get the function back in my leg/foot due to the location of the disc herniation. He said he would not operate on me because he wont be able to make it any better than it is now. The Atrophy of my leg is not a new thing but has happened over time and most likely wont go much farther. Does not want to see me unless my Foot drop gets worse. Bobby Buggs Posted December 8, 2007 Author Report Share Posted December 8, 2007 I rode the week after the herniation but had an injection. I waited 3 months then had the operation in April 05. Rode next season and last year as well. Riding never really made my back hurt, sitting in the chair can be a bit uncomfortable.
